The 2023 Chevrolet Bolt Electric Utility Vehicle (EUV) crossover is available in two trims. The entry-level LT trim starts at $27,800, and the top-tier Premier trim starts at $32,300 and is equipped with all of the LT’s optional packages plus exclusive features. 
  • The Bolt EUV LT and Premier share the same single-motor, 65-kWh electric powertrain with a maximum driving range of 247 miles.
  • The Premier trim adds HD surround cameras and adaptive cruise control in addition to the LT’s optional upgrade packages.
  • Adding all the LT’s option packages brings the price gap between the two trims down to $1,415, meaning you’re getting the Premier’s adaptive cruise control at a fantastic value.

LT: The Chevy Bolt EUV’s base model

2023 starting MSRP: $27,800
The entry-level 2023 Chevy Bolt EUV LT pairs a single electric motor with a 65-kWh battery for the following powertrain specs:
  • EPA-rated 247-mile driving range on a full charge
  • 7.5-hour charging time at 220V/240V
  • Front-wheel drive
  • Maximum 200 horsepower and 266 lb-ft of torque
  • 6.8-second zero-to-60 acceleration time
For a base model, the EUV LT includes an impressive list of standard features:
  • Android Auto, Apple CarPlay, Amazon Alexa, and bluetooth connectivity
  • Wireless device charger 
  • Wi-fi hotspot compatibility
  • 10-inch touchscreen infotainment display with integrated climate controls
  • Keyless entry with remote start
  • HD radio
  • LED head- and tail-lights
  • 17-inch allow wheels
The Bolt EUV LT also features the following driver-assistance safety features courtesy of Chevy’s “Safety Assist”
  • Automatic emergency braking with pedestrian detection
  • Lane-departure warning and lane-keep assist
  • Forward collision alert
  • StabiliTrak traction control system

Premier: Bundles your Chevy Bolt EUV’s upgrades

2023 starting MSRP: $32,300
The Chevrolet Bolt EUV Premier trim shares the same powertrain as the less-expensive LT trim. As such, the Premier comes standard with all the LT’s available package upgrades to justify the additional $4,500 cost.
The Premier trim includes the following exclusive features that you cannot add to the EUV LT:
  • Adaptive cruise control
  • Extra cameras for surround-view parking
  • Integrated rearview mirror camera mode
The Driver Confidence Package ($495 for the LT) includes extra driver-assist tech:
  • Rear parking sensors and assist
  • Blind-spot monitoring with rear cross-traffic alert
  • Lane-change alert with side blind zone alert 
The Comfort Package ($895 for the LT) adds creature comforts for the driver:
  • Eight-way power-adjustable driver’s seat
  • Heated front seats
  • Heated steering wheel
The Convenience Package ($1,695 for the LT) ups the Bolt EUV’s luxury:
  • Leather upholstery in jet black or nightshift blue
  • Rear center armrest with two additional cupholders for rearseat passengers
  • Five-spoke aluminum wheels with black and silver accents. 
The Bolt EUV Premier is also available with the following exclusive package upgrades:
  • Super Cruise package ($2,200): Adds Chevy’s Super Cruise hands-free driving on compatible roads with enhanced automatic emergency braking.
  • Sun and Sound package ($2,495): Adds power-adjustable panoramic sunroof, a premium Bose seven-speaker audio system, and Chevy Infotainment 3 Plus with integrated navigation.

LT vs. Premier: The Premier justifies the price

A fully decked-out 2023 Chevy Bolt EUV LT with all the available package upgrades runs for $30,885, compared to the Premier’s starting price of $32,300. 
Is the $1,415 price difference worth it: At the end of the day, the Chevy Bolt EUV Premier charges an additional $1,415 for adaptive cruise control and an HD surround camera system.   The average price to add an adaptive cruise control package in the US is $2,000 to $2,500.
The bottom line: 
  • The 2023 Chevy Bolt EUV LT is the best choice if you want the most affordable option with cheap customization options.
  • The 2023 Chevy Bolt EUV Premier is the best choice if you want as many driver assistance and convenience features as possible with options for even more.
